[发明专利]一种触摸阈值设置方法、设备及存储介质在审
申请号: | 201710283113.0 | 申请日: | 2017-04-26 |
公开(公告)号: | CN107145257A | 公开(公告)日: | 2017-09-08 |
发明(设计)人: | 陈海华 | 申请(专利权)人: | 努比亚技术有限公司 |
主分类号: | G06F3/041 | 分类号: | G06F3/041;G06F3/044 |
代理公司: | 工业和信息化部电子专利中心11010 | 代理人: | 于金平 |
地址: | 518057 广东省深圳市南山区高新区北环大道9018*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 触摸 阈值 设置 方法 设备 存储 介质 | ||
技术领域
本发明涉及移动终端领域,尤其涉及一种触摸阈值设置方法、设备及存储介质。
背景技术
一般使用触摸屏移动终端的用户都有过这种体验,新的移动终端触摸屏的反映非常灵敏,但在移动终端使用半年或者一年之后,其触摸屏的反应会变得迟钝,甚至会出现终端的界面随意跳转的现象,例如,即使用户并未点击某个响应区域,移动终端界面也会弹出相应界面。
通常在移动终端出厂后,触摸阈值(V_threshold)就是固定的了,该V_threshold是用来判断终端的触摸屏是否被触控的阀值,V_threshold=V_base+V_Offset,当对移动终端的触摸屏进行触摸操作时,触摸屏会读取到的该触摸操作对应的当前电容值(V_current),当判断当前电容值大于触摸阈值时判断为有触摸,当判断当前电容值(V_current)小于触摸阈值(V_threshold),则判断为无触摸。其中,V_base(基准值)是在触摸屏没有任何触摸屏操作时的值,一般手机出厂时该值即被确定。V_Offset(偏移值)用来计算是否有手指触摸的值,这个是固定的值。V_current(当前电容值)是触摸屏根据触摸信号读取到的当前感应值。在移动终端使用一段时间后,触摸屏自身的电容值也会发生变化,如:触摸屏上有污渍、汗水或者触摸屏被重压等,都会改变触摸屏的V_base,一旦触摸屏的V_base改变了,那么出厂时的触摸阈值V_threshold就不再适用,这时,触摸屏就会出现不灵敏,甚至是随意跳转页面的现象。
发明内容
本发明的主要目的在于提出一种触摸阈值设置方法、设备及存储介质,旨在解决相关技术中触摸屏在使用一段时间后由于其电容值变化导致触摸屏反应不灵敏的问题。
根据本发明的一个方面,提供了一种触摸阈值设置方法,该触摸阈值设置方法包括:在终端进入触摸阈值设置模式后,获取接收到的触摸信号产生的电容值;将电容值设置为终端触摸屏的触摸阈值。
可选的,在获取接收到的触摸信号对应的电容值的步骤之前,还包括:接收用户操作;确定用户操作是否为预先指定的操作;在确定用户操作是预先指定的操作的情况下,控制终端进入触摸阈值设置模式。
可选的,确定用户操作是否为预先指定的操作的步骤包括:检测终端的至少两个物理按键是否同时被按下;在至少两个物理按键同时被按下的情况下,确定至少两个物理按键处于被按下状态所持续的时长是否满足第一预设时长;在至少两个物理按键处于被按下状态所持续的时长满足第一预设时长的情况下,确定用户操作是预先指定的操作。
可选的,在确定用户操作是预先指定的操作的步骤之后,还包括:确定在第二预设时长内执行设置触摸阈值的步骤的次数是否超过预设次数;在确定在第二预设时长内执行设置触摸阈值的步骤的次数未超过预设次数的情况下,执行将电容值设置为终端触摸屏的触摸阈值的步骤,否则不执行将电容值设置为终端触摸屏的触摸阈值的步骤。
可选的,获取接收到的触摸信号所生成的电容值的步骤包括:当在第三预设时长内接收到多个触摸信号的情况下,分别获取多个触摸信号所产生的多个电容值;计算多个电容的平均值;将电容值设置为终端触摸屏的触摸阈值的步骤包括:将计算得到的平均值设置为终端触摸屏的触摸阈值。
根据本发明的另一个方面,提供了一种触摸阈值设置设备,该触摸阈值设置设备包括处理器、存储器以及通信总线:通信总线用于实现处理器和存储器之间的连接通信;处理器用于执行存储器中存储的触摸阈值设置程序,以实现以下步骤:在终端进入触摸阈值设置模式后,获取接收到的触摸信号所产生的电容值;将电容设置为终端触摸屏的触摸阈值。
可选的,在获取接收到的触摸信号所产生的电容值的步骤之前,还包括:接收用户操作;确定用户操作是否为预先指定的操作;在确定用户操作是预先指定的操作的情况下,控制终端进入触摸阈值设置模式。
可选的,确定用户操作是否为预先指定的操作的步骤包括:检测终端的至少两个物理按键是否同时被按下;在至少两个物理按键同时被按下的情况下,确定至少两个物理按键处于被按下状态所持续的时长是否满足第一预设时长;在至少两个物理按键处于被按下状态所持续的时长满足第一预设时长的情况下,确定用户操作是预先指定的操作。
可选的,获取接收到的触摸信号所产生的电容值的步骤包括:当在第三预设时长内接收到多个触摸信号的情况下,获取多个触摸信号所产生的多个电容值;计算多个电容值的平均值;将电容值设置为终端触摸屏的触摸阈值的步骤包括:将计算得到的平均值设置为终端触摸屏的触摸阈值。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于努比亚技术有限公司,未经努比亚技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710283113.0/2.html,转载请声明来源钻瓜专利网。